Frequently Asked Questions — Citation VII
How many passengers does the Citation VII seat?
Typical seating for the Citation VII is 8 passengers. Seating varies by operator configuration.
How much baggage can the Citation VII carry?
The Citation VII typically offers 61 ft³ of baggage volume (~6 typical bags). Actual baggage capacity varies by configuration and payload.
What are the cabin dimensions of the Citation VII?
Typical cabin dimensions (H × W × L): 5.7 × 5.8 × 18.4 ft. Cabin layouts can vary by aircraft and refurbishment.
What is the range and speed of a Citation VII?
Typical range is 2350 nm (~5.1 hrs). Typical cruise speed is 460 KTAS. Real-world performance varies with payload, winds, routing, and reserves.
Does the Citation VII typically include a flight attendant?
Flight attendant availability is typically listed as: n. Availability depends on operator and cabin configuration.
When was the Citation VII manufactured?
The Citation VII was manufactured from 1992 to 2000. Exact production years can vary by variant and market.

Evolution & OEM Highlights
Evolution / Lineage: Evolution & OEM Evolution / Lineage – Higher‑performance evolution of Citation III with more powerful engines and avionics updates. Key Upgrades – Higher‑thrust engines, faster cruise, upgraded avionics and premium interior. ““The Citation VII delivers higher cruise speeds, improved climb performance, and enhanced cabin comfort.”” Source · Cessna (Textron Aviation)
Key Upgrades: Higher‑thrust engines, faster cruise, upgraded avionics and premium interior.
